The 2015 (*+) was released on August 17, 2019 at $21.95. Here is my previous note: Extremely deep intense purple colour. Peppery, youthful, herbal-driven nose with some leesy-resiny notes. Dry, medium bodied, spicy, herbal, resiny, stewed plum flavours with a lingering, youthful, high acid finish. Has 14.5% alcohol and 4 g/L residual sugar with lot number L19102 on the back label. |

TASTING NOTE: This shows a lovely smoky and bark-like note, which works very well with the brambleberries and underbrush. Full-bodied with nicely chewy tannins that remain tightly wound. Vibrant and fruity at the same time. Drink now or hold. Score - 93 (James Suckling, jamessuckling.com, March 27, 2019) |
